INGREDIENTS
Cream Cheese Cookies
- 120g cream cheese
- 120g unsalted butter
- đź§‚ 200g sugar
- 🥚 1 egg
- 5g vanilla extract
- 220g all-purpose flour
- 4g baking powder
- 3g cornstarch
- đź§‚ 2g salt
STEPS
Bring cream cheese, butter, and egg to room temperature until soft. In a bowl, mix flour, cornstarch, baking powder, and salt with a whisk.
In another bowl, beat softened cream cheese, butter, and sugar until fluffy and light for about 2 minutes.
Add egg and vanilla extract to the mixture and whip for an additional minute.
Gradually fold in the dry ingredients using a spatula, mixing gently to avoid overmixing.
Cover the dough with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 1 hour.
Preheat the oven to 190°C (375°F). Divide the dough into 15 portions, roll into balls, and place on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
Flatten each ball slightly using a spatula or glass bottom.
Bake in the preheated oven for 10–12 minutes until the bottoms turn golden brown.
Cool cookies on the baking sheet for 20 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
Dust the cooled cookies with powdered sugar for a finishing touch.

đź’ˇ Tips
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for smooth mixing.Chill the dough to enhance flavor and texture.Monitor baking time closely to avoid overbaking.Dust with powdered sugar for a festive look.
